Throughout this manual, the term ‘pulse’ is used to describe the mechanical stroke of the pump, as strokes per minute
(SPM).
4.1.1 Proportional Mode
The unit is shipped preset at the factory for the ‘PROPORTIONAL’ or ‘ON/OFF’ mode. To change the unit to the opposite
mode see ‘Advanced Menu List,’ Option 2, on page 20.
Controller must be in ‘OFF’ mode to program changes.
